I believe the third approach should be taken for the following reasons: 1. Formaldehyde consumes a large amount of methanol – 440 kilograms of methanol are required per ton of formaldehyde. 2. Polyoxymethylene resin (POM) is a new type of material with high added value and great market potential; it is known as the \"king of plastics\". However, the related technology is controlled by foreign companies such as DuPont, BASF, and Mitsubishi Gas, and no mature technology exists in China
